How Is Property Divided in Florida?

Florida law calls for equitable distribution. Do not mistake equitable for meaning the same as equal. Equitable means fair. Fair is not always equal.

To determine what is fair, there are many factors that must be considered. These factors include the length of the marriage, the economic situation of each spouse, the amount of non-marital property that each spouse possesses and more.

In the eyes of the law, it may be fair for one spouse to get a larger portion of marital property if, for example, he or she chose to forego educational or career opportunities to raise a family. The goal of our property division attorney is to pursue an outcome that is fair to you.
